If purchasing power parity holds, then 1 Mikeland Dollar must be worth 1 Coffeeville Peso. Otherwise, there is the chance of making a risk-free profit by buying footballs in one market and selling in the other. So here PPP requires a 1 for 1 exchange rate. "A Better Way to Buy" and "Powering People to a Better Life" are trademarks, and "Purchasing Power" is a registered trademark, of Purchasing Power, LLC. ...To put it another way, the purchasing power of a dollar is $1.18 in Mississippi and $0.84 in Hawaii. The net impact of accounting for differences in the purchasing power of a dollar in different states is to narrow the gap in the standard of living between rich and poor states. The rights granted by a power of attorney are limited by both the terms...Jan 30, 2024 · Margin buying power is traders’ total money in their margin accounts to buy securities. It is the cash in their brokerage accounts plus margin loans. Usually, excess equity is twice as much as the margin amount. So, if traders have $50,000 in their margin accounts, they can buy $100,000 worth of securities on margin. This is similar to nominal GDP per capita but adjusted for the cost of living in each country.. In 2019, the estimated average GDP per …Solution: P1 = 109. P2 = $4 (1$=50) = 4*50 = 200. S = P1 / P2. Purchasing Power Parity = 109/200. Purchasing Power Parity = 0.545. So purchasing power parity between India and US is 0.545 for the paneer king burger. PPPs are the rates of currency conversion that equalize the purchasing power of different currencies by eliminating the differences in price levels between countries. In their simplest form, PPPs are simply price relatives that show the ratio of the prices in national currencies of the same good or service in different countries. This second ...
